Victorian flood recovery - for business
The Department of Human Services coordinates a range of assistance from State Government and not for profit organisations for businesses in emergency recovery situations, such as those experienced following a flood.
The 2011 floods impacted businesses and agriculture heavily across the state. As a result, a range of commonwealth, state and local government agencies are working together to help with their recovery efforts.
Help available:
- Financial support for business and agriculture in the form of grants and gifts that can assist with the task of cleaning up and rebuilding
- Information for farmers to help retain apprentices, find financial counsellors and the flood recovery employment program
- Advice and information on cleaning up after the floods or restoring the land
- Information on insurance claims for damage caused by flooding
